Immediately after the collection, the cord blood unit is shipped towards the lab and processed, then cryopreserved. There are many methods to method a cord blood unit, and there are differing viewpoints on what the most effective way is. Some processing methods independent out the red blood cells and take away them, while others preserve the pink blood cells. However the device is processed, a cryopreservant is added into the cord blood to allow the cells to outlive the cryogenic approach.

Personal storage of one's own cord blood is unlawful in Italy and France, and It's also discouraged in Another European nations around the world. The American Medical Affiliation states "Non-public banking need to be regarded as in the unusual circumstance when there exists a spouse and children predisposition into a problem through which umbilical cord stem cells are therapeutically indicated. On the other hand, on account of its cost, confined probability of use, and inaccessibility to Some others, non-public banking shouldn't be recommended to lower-threat people."[24] The American Society for Blood and Marrow Transplantation and the American Congress of Obstetricians and Gynecologists also motivate community cord banking and discourage personal cord blood banking.

Cord blood is definitely the blood contained within the placental blood vessels and umbilical cord, which connects an unborn child on the mom's womb. Cord blood has hematopoietic progenitor cells. At delivery, cord blood is usually gathered (or "recovered") through the umbilical cord.
